Warning Signs You Need Storm Damage Restoration
Catching storm damage early is key to preventing more serious and costly issues down the line. Ignoring these signs can lead to widespread problems that affect your home’s structure and your family’s health. Be vigilant and understand what to look for after severe weather. Early detection means faster, more effective repairs.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
These are often the first visible signs of a roof leak or compromised flashing. Even small, faint stains can indicate that water is seeping into your home’s structure. You should investigate these immediately to prevent further damage.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ent damp or musty smell, especially in attics, basements, or closets,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. This smell often means there’s an ongoing water problem that needs professional attention.
Loose or Missing Shingles
High winds can lift, crack, or completely tear off shingles. Even if you don’t see a leak inside, missing shingles leave your roof deck exposed to the elements, leading to rapid water damage.
Cracked or Damaged Gutters and Downspouts
Storms can bend or dislodge gutters, preventing them from directing water away from your foundation. Improper drainage can lead to basement flooding and expensive foundation repairs.
Damp or Sagging Insulation
Waterlogged insulation loses its effectiveness and can lead to mold growth within your walls and attic. Sagging insulation is a clear sign that it has absorbed moisture and needs professional assessment and replacement.
Electrical Issues or Flickering Lights
Water and electricity are a dangerous combination. If you notice any electrical problems after a storm, it could be due to water intrusion affecting your wiring. This is a serious hazard that requires immediate professional inspection.
Storm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or roof granule loss | Yes | No | Usually cosmetic and doesn’t impact immediate integrity. |
| Small puddle in a corner of a room | Yes | Yes | Water can spread unseen beneath flooring, requiring specialized drying. |
| Loose tree branches on lawn | Yes | Yes | For safety and to check for damage to your home’s exterior. |
| Visible hole in the roof | No | Yes | Requires immediate tarping and professional repair to prevent extensive interior damage. |
| Musty smell in the attic | No | Yes | Indicates hidden moisture and potential mold, needing professional assessment and remediation. |
| Damaged siding or window seals | Yes (minor) | Yes (major) | Small dings can be cosmetic, but larger breaches need professional sealing to prevent water entry. |
While some minor storm-related cleanup can be handled yourself, it’s crucial to know your limits. For any situation involving potential water intrusion, structural compromise, or electrical hazards, calling a professional is the safest and most effective choice. They have the tools and expertise to ensure complete and safe restoration.
Storm Damage Restoration Cost In Alta Mesa, AZ
The cost of storm damage restoration in Alta Mesa, AZ can vary widely based on the severity of the storm, the size of the affected area, and the extent of the damage. These figures are general estimates, and an on-site assessment is necessary for an accurate quote. We aim to provide transparent pricing for your peace of mind.
| Service Aspect |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Tarping/Board-Up | $300 – $1,000 | Size of the damaged area and complexity of access. |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$1,000 – $5,000+ | Amount of water, size of affected rooms, and drying time needed. |
| Debris Removal | $400 – $2,000 | Volume of debris and accessibility for removal equipment. |
| Roof Repair | $1,000 – $10,000+ | Extent of shingle damage, underlayment issues, or structural roof deck problems. |
| Siding and Exterior Repair | $500 – $5,000+ | Type of siding, size of the damaged section, and complexity of the repair. |
| Interior Reconstruction (Drywall, Paint) | $500 – $3,000 per room | Square footage, material choices, and the need for specialized finishes. |

Common Questions About Storm Damage Restoration
What should I do immediately after a storm damages my home?
First, ensure your family’s safety and stay away from damaged areas if there are any immediate hazards. Document the damage with photos or videos for insurance purposes. Then, contact a professional restoration company like ours to perform an emergency assessment and begin mitigation efforts. We can help secure your property and prevent further damage.
How much does storm damage restoration cost?
The cost varies significantly based on the extent of the damage, the size of your home, and the specific repairs needed. Factors like roof damage, water intrusion, and structural repairs all influence the final price. We provide detailed estimates after a thorough inspection.
Will my homeowner’s insurance cover storm damage restoration?
Most homeowner’s insurance policies cover damage caused by storms, including wind and hail. However, coverage details can vary. We work with insurance adjusters to ensure the process is as smooth as possible and that you receive the coverage you’re entitled to for proper restoration.
How long does storm damage restoration typically take?
The timeline depends heavily on the severity of the damage. Minor repairs might take a few days, while extensive water damage and reconstruction could take several weeks. Our goal is always to work as efficiently as possible while ensuring a thorough and lasting repair.
What are the health risks associated with storm damage?
The primary health risk comes from standing water and subsequent mold growth, which can cause respiratory problems and allergic reactions. Damaged structures also pose physical safety risks. Prompt professional drying and remediation are essential for your family’s well-being.
